# Artifact Signing — ScanBridge

All ScanBridge barcode-scanner integration builds must be signed before upload to the Larkspur artifact store. Unsigned bundles are rejected by the kiosk firmware. Run the packager, then invoke the signer against the output tarball. Verification happens automatically on the device at boot. For local testing and staging uploads, sign with the shared staging key shown below.

rollout seal: bky9_PeXH1fTLY

# Pooling config for the Quillbase service — flagged at weekly sync.
# Pool sizing: POOL_MIN=4, POOL_MAX=32; idle reap at 300s.
# Marisol's load test showed saturation above 28 connections on the Tarn cluster,
# so do not raise POOL_MAX without a sync discussion.
# Failover replica is read-only; the pooler routes writes to primary automatically.
# Health checks hit /poolstat every 15s; alerts go to the eng channel.
# The pooler authenticates to the Quillbase primary with a shared credential, which goes on the next line.

vault entry, tagug-tawef: LEDGER_TOKEN5=8573d

## Who to ping: snapshot tests

If Glimmerkit snapshot tests start failing on the UI components repo, first check whether someone merged an intentional visual change without updating baselines — that's the culprit nine times out of ten. Re-record snapshots locally and compare diffs before reverting anything. For flaky renders or baseline storage issues, the Glimmerkit maintainers are your people. Reach them at the address below.

escalation mailbox, bafog-fafog: ulador@paliqlabs.internal